It’s been about a week since the Philadelphia Flyers’ season ended at the hands of the New York Islanders — just writing that was enough to provoke a gag reflex.
For the next few months, there will be a lot of talk regarding the changes the Flyers need to make this offseason. And there are a decent amount of them. For one, the Flyers need to do something — anything — to fix their atrocity of a power play. They also need to evaluate whether or not veterans such as Justin Braun or Tyler Pitlick will return for the 2020-21 season.
